The Green Bay Packers agreed to terms with guard Aaron Banks and cornerback Nate Hobbs to open the legal tampering period on Monday, but other teams in the NFC North have been active to open free agency, too.
In fact, the Chicago Bears and Minnesota Vikings have been two of the most active teams during the early window, and the Detroit Lions are lurking as a team with plenty of money spend.
The Packers lost to the Bears in the season finale and finished 0-4 against the Vikings and Lions in 2024, so there's work to be done in terms of keeping up in the division.
